[2J10]Report on the Practice of Study Groups for Learning about Nuclear Disaster Prevention by Citizens' Groups

*Haruka Osugi1,2 (1. The Great East Japan Earthquake and Nuclear Disaster Memorial Museum, 2. Tohoku Univ.)

Keywords:

Nuclear Disaster Prevention,Radiation Education,Risk communication

A study session was held with the aim of learning about “nuclear disaster prevention”, led by the general public who are interested in disaster prevention on a daily basis.This presentation will report on the content of the study session and the results of a questionnaire survey conducted on the participants of the study session.The results of the questionnaire suggested that learning about the risks of nuclear power plants around us can be a trigger for creating opportunities for dialogue about radioactive waste and the decommissioning of the Fukushima Daiichi Nuclear Power Plant.
